Or just a bear trap. This is a classical falling wedge pattern btw.  
https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wedge_pattern
"When this pattern is found in an uptrend, it is considered a bullish pattern, as the market range becomes narrower into the correction, indicating that the downward trend is losing strength and the resumption of the uptrend is in the making. "
Since the creation of Bitcoin we are in an uptrend, so its resumption is in the making.
I expect a strong breakout soon. Moreover, any moment CFTC will approve ICE futures (the so called bakkt) which is with an actual buying of bitcoins. So we may see above 10K sooner than expected!

If we break out to $10k+ very soon, we're probably not going to hold that price point for long. It would most likely lead to lower lows (sub $5k).

I'd much prefer we go sideways for a while.
Sub 5K is too much. Even now the miners are with a very slim profit. At 5K only those who have free electricity (may be less than 1%) will have any profit in terms of cents. Once we are out of the falling wedge pattern, the trade differs of what we've had before. So even if we don't hold 10K for long, the correction will not be in the 6K area, but much higher - say 8K. Then the upward trend will resume until the next resistance and so on.

Ripple really shouldn't be considered cryptocurrency.

Why even put it in the above list of 10 top coins, when there is no reason to consider it a cryptocurrency if it doesn't need a blockchain.
You could just make the whole system more efficient and make it a simple centralized payment processor.

So many projects nowadays forcefully put their data into blockchains when they don't need them.
Just makes the whole system slower for no reason.

Since they are already centralized, one of these days they will come up with an amazing new unique idea to replace a blockchain with a simple ledger for efficiency purposes. They will become just a normal bank and reach their full potential.
